The cheetah (Acinonyx jubatus) is one of the fastest mammals found in the animal kingdom today. I have searched through many books and other references to find that the maximum speed of a cheetah is documented with the speed of about 30 m/s (70 mph).
The book of cheetahs I found said that every part of a cheetah's body is made for speed. Its body is slender, light and its long tail helps it to stay balanced. The bones of a cheetah are designed to take punishment. The claws of the Cheetah do not retract, they grip the ground and help cheetah push off the same way a track shoe with cleats help a runner start a race.
From standing start, a cheetah can accelerate from zero to 20 m/s in two seconds, at a rate of 10 m/s2. Most race cars cannot accelerate that fast.
